SUWON. Suwon prevailed over Suwon Bluewings to win 2-1. It was Suwon to strike first with a goal of Lee Gwang-Hyeok at the 41′. Then Murilo scored again for Suwon in the 53′ minute. Eventually, Kyeong-jung Kim reduced the distance for Suwon Bluewings (69′). Eventually, that was it, and the result remained 2-1. Suwon Bluewings lost this match even if it was better in terms of ball possession (60%).
The match was played at the Suwon Civil Stadium Auxiliary stadium in Suwon on Saturday and it started at 2:00 pm local time.
